Set in northern Mozambique on the eve of World War I, "A Cegueira do Rio" explores a tumultuous period marked by colonial conflict, where language and reading become vital tools of resistance and salvation. Inspired by a real event, the story highlights how local communities find refuge in their own language amid the pressures of war and colonization. Through Mia Couto’s distinctive voice, the novel emphasizes the importance of preserving memory and culture as sources of hope in times of adversity.
